Hey all, I’m utilizing the /incidents API to fetch all incidents for an internal report. From what I can tell the since/until date parameter is filtering based on the created_at date. Does anyone know if there is a way to filter based on the updated_at field? I’d like to incrementally load a warehouse with the incidents from this API, but you can’t really do that if you can only filter by the created_at date.

Hello,Am trying to setup rundeck :4.11(with customized docker image) with MySQL azure:8.0.42 as database.Am struck with the liquibase below error:Issue:“Caused by: liquibase.exception.MigrationFailedException: Migration failed for change set core/WorkflowWorkflowStepPrimaryKey.groovy::1653585641550-1::rundeckuser (generated): Reason: liquibase.exception.DatabaseException: Incorrect table definition; there can be only one auto column and it must be defined as a key [Failed SQL: (1075) ALTER TABLE poc_rundeck.workflow_workflow_step ADD id BIGINT AUTO_INCREMENT NOT NULL PRIMARY KEY] at liquibase.changelog.ChangeSet.execute(ChangeSet.java:696)”. When I tried the same instance on flexible server database with MySQL:8.0.25, it is running without any error.I have done all the prerequisites mentioned in the official documentation regarding “sql_generate_invisible_primary_key > Change its value to OFF”, sql mode also off. Our open-source API client for Python has now been refactored from a monolithic one-file module into a multi-file module. This change is being made to fulfill a need for long-term maintainability and improved readability. This new release does not add new features, but aims to make contribution of new features far easier going forward, most notably enabling us to add a py.typed file to enable using typehints in projects (issue #26).
